As climate variability intensifies and pressure on natural resources grows, the need for smarter, data-driven crop management has never been greater. Precision Agriculture presents a forward-looking yet practical examination of how advanced technologies are reshaping modern farming into a more productive, efficient, and sustainable enterprise.
Precision Agriculture: Concepts, Strategies, and Case Studies brings together leading experts from agriculture, data science, engineering, and agricultural policy to explore the integration of artificial intelligence, machine learning, remote sensing, geospatial technologies, IoT-enabled systems, and decision-support tools. Moving beyond conceptual discussions, the book emphasizes real-world implementation through applied frameworks and case studies that demonstrate improved yield optimization, resource-use efficiency, and climate resilience across diverse agro-ecological settings.
In addition to technological innovation, the volume addresses the policy, regulatory, and ethical dimensions essential for responsible digital transformation in agriculture. By combining current advances with emerging trends, it equips readers with both operational insights and strategic foresight necessary to navigate the evolving landscape of smart farming.
Serving as both a reference and a practical guide, this book is designed for researchers, agricultural professionals, policymakers, and postgraduate students seeking to harness precision technologies for sustainable and climate-resilient crop production. As part of the Nextgen Agriculture: Novel Concepts and Innovative Strategies series, this book offers the analytical depth and applied orientation required to support informed decision-making and long-term agricultural transformation.
